Output 6dbdb95f8368d04780539ea4fb85e76c38066714529c13deb2bef41bbcbca7fb:0

value
1011562
script pubkey
OP_0 OP_PUSHBYTES_20 2bdbd66bbd87903e57d44da920c15ec53c0b63f0
address
bc1q90dav6aas7gru475fk5jps27c57qkclsjdm650
transaction
6dbdb95f8368d04780539ea4fb85e76c38066714529c13deb2bef41bbcbca7fb
confirmations
242844
spent
true